2. Information we collect

  • Account and organization data: name, email address, login credentials, organization name, team membership, role, preferences, and support communications.
  • Social connection data: provider and account identifiers, Page or professional-account names, usernames, profile images, granted permissions, OAuth access and refresh tokens, token expiry, and connection status.
  • Publishing data: drafts, captions, media references, schedules, settings, publishing results, public post identifiers, links, comments, and analytics requested by your organization.
  • Inbox data: messages sent to or from a connected Facebook Page or Instagram professional account, public Threads replies, sender identifiers, names, usernames, attachments, timestamps, delivery/read states, and internal team notes.
  • Technical data: IP address, browser and device information, request metadata, security events, application logs, queue and webhook status, and feature usage.
  • Billing data: subscription and transaction records where a paid service applies. Payment-card details are handled by the applicable payment provider rather than stored in full by KOLab.

8. Retention and deletion

We keep information for as long as an account or integration is active and as needed to provide the service, satisfy contractual or legal requirements, resolve disputes, prevent abuse, and maintain security records. Retention periods depend on the data and purpose.

Disconnecting or deleting a social integration stops KOLab from using its stored credentials. A verified Meta deletion callback removes or anonymizes the matching credentials, platform identifiers, inbox data, and associated stored publishing data from active systems. Minimal confirmation and audit records may be retained to demonstrate that a request was completed. Isolated backup copies expire through the normal protected backup lifecycle and are not used for ordinary processing.

9. Security

We use HTTPS/TLS, access controls, tenant-scoped application queries, signed webhook verification, operational monitoring, restricted production access, and other technical and organizational safeguards. No internet service can guarantee absolute security. Users must protect their login credentials and promptly report suspected misuse.
